Grant Overview

In the realm of environment grants focused on clean air initiatives, operations center on the precise replacement of off-road equipment to curb air pollution emissions. This involves swapping diesel-powered machinery such as excavators, loaders, and generators with zero-emission or near-zero emission alternatives eligible for awards between $10,000 and $250,000. Applicants must demonstrate how these replacements integrate into ongoing workflows without halting critical activities. Concrete use cases include construction firms upgrading fleet vehicles on job sites, mining operations converting portable power units, and industrial facilities retrofitting material handlers. Organizations equipped to manage equipment downtime and certification processes should apply, while those lacking technical expertise in emissions verification or without off-road assets tied to air quality impacts should refrain. Scope boundaries exclude on-road vehicles, stationary sources, or non-equipment pollution controls, ensuring operations remain laser-focused on mobile machinery transitions.

Operational trends in environmental funding reflect stringent policy shifts toward electrification. Market pressures from regulations like the California Air Resources Board's (CARB) Off-Road Diesel Regulation mandate compliance for equipment over 25 horsepower, prioritizing projects that achieve at least 90% emissions reductions. Grantors favor battery-electric or hydrogen fuel cell technologies, requiring applicants to possess baseline capacity in fleet management software and EV charging infrastructure planning. Capacity needs escalate with project scale; smaller $10,000 awards suit single-unit swaps, while $250,000 projects demand multi-site coordination. Environmental grants for nonprofits increasingly emphasize scalable operations that align with broader epa climate pollution reduction grants frameworks, pushing recipients to pre-qualify equipment via CARB's equipment search tool before submission.

Streamlining Workflows for Off-Road Equipment Replacement in Environment Grants

Delivery in grants for environmental projects hinges on a structured workflow: initial inventory audit, compatibility assessment, procurement, installation, and verification testing. Begin with cataloging existing off-road equipment, noting model year, hours of use, and baseline NOx/PM emissions using EPA or CARB calculators. Next, select replacements from verified lists, ensuring interoperability with site power gridsa unique constraint where off-road terrain complicates charging station deployment, often requiring portable solar-integrated units. Staffing demands a core team: a project engineer for technical specs, a compliance officer for documentation, and logistics coordinators for transport. Resource requirements include $5,000-$20,000 in upfront matching funds for shipping and training, plus access to certified mechanics trained in high-voltage systems. Workflow bottlenecks arise during the mandatory 30-day shakedown period post-installation, where equipment must log operational hours under load to validate performance.

One verifiable delivery challenge unique to this sector is retrofitting equipment in remote or uneven terrains, where standard EV chargers fail due to soil instability and limited grid access, necessitating custom-engineered solutions like skid-mounted batteries. Operations must account for this by phasing replacements: prioritize high-use assets first to minimize cumulative downtime, targeting under 5% fleet unavailability. Daily logs track fuel savings and uptime, feeding into quarterly progress reports.

Mitigating Risks and Ensuring Measurable Outcomes in Environmental Funding Operations

Eligibility barriers in environmental grants for nonprofit organizations include failure to provide pre- and post-project emissions inventories, often trapping applicants in non-compliance if data lacks third-party validation. Compliance traps involve overlooking CARB's reporting thresholds; projects exceeding 50 tons annual emissions require additional permitting. What receives no funding: routine maintenance, non-zero-emission hybrids below Tier 4 Final standards, or projects without direct air pollution linkage. Risk management demands contingency planning for supply chain delays in battery sourcing, which can extend timelines by 6-12 months.

Measurement protocols enforce outcomes like 75%+ reduction in particulate matter and verifiable operational hours on new equipment. KPIs encompass emissions avoided (tons/year), equipment utilization rates (>80%), and cost-per-ton abated (<$5,000). Reporting requires annual submissions via online portals, including GPS-tracked usage data and independent audits for awards over $100,000. Successful operations demonstrate sustained integration, with follow-up inspections at 12 and 24 months to confirm no reversion to fossil fuels.
